Significance: The HIPAR equipment building was built in 1958 from standardized drawings approved by the Corps of Engineers. Nike buildings were considered modified emergency buildings. Originally, they were to be pre-fabricated structures, but were rather unsightly and did not contribute to troop morale and, therefore, were changed to modified emergency design.
